buildframework/helium/sf/java/legacy/src/com/nokia/ant/util/ToolsProcess.java
changeset 628 7c4a911dc066
parent 587 85df38eb4012
equal deleted inserted replaced
588:c7c26511138f 628:7c4a911dc066
    15 *
    15 *
    16 */
    16 */
    17 
    17 
    18 package com.nokia.ant.util;
    18 package com.nokia.ant.util;
    19 
    19 
    20 import java.util.Hashtable;
    20 import org.apache.log4j.Logger;
    21 
    21 
    22 import com.nokia.tools.Tool;
    22 import com.nokia.tools.Tool;
    23 import com.nokia.tools.ToolsProcessException;
    23 import com.nokia.tools.ToolsProcessException;
    24 import org.apache.log4j.Logger;
       
    25 /**
    24 /**
    26  * Utility class to read property value, if property is not defined it will raise an exception.
    25  * Utility class to read property value, if property is not defined it will raise an exception.
    27  *
    26  *
    28  */
    27  */
    29 public final class ToolsProcess {
    28 public final class ToolsProcess {
    30     private static Hashtable tools = new Hashtable();
       
    31 
       
    32     private static Logger log;
    29     private static Logger log;
    33     
    30     
    34     private ToolsProcess() { }
    31     private ToolsProcess() { }
    35 
    32 
    36     public static Tool getTool(String reqTool) throws ToolsProcessException {
    33     public static Tool getTool(String reqTool) throws ToolsProcessException {